Vermonters pitch in to aid storm victims
Fund-raisers of all sizes being held
A 94-year-old woman from New Orleans who lost everything in Hurricane Katrina sent in a check for $25. Kids at a Vermont elementary school collected coins for a week, raising $2,000. The rock band Phish performed a benefit, raising about $1.2 million. And a man from Northampton, Mass., mailed a check for $500 after driving on flood-ravaged Route 4 in Mendon.
